What are the instructions for submitting this form?
Submit the IRS Verification of Non-Filing Letter directly to the CSI Financial Aid Office. You can send it via email to financialaid@csi.edu, or fax it to 208.732.6294. Additionally, printed letters can be mailed to the CSI Financial Aid Office at 315 Falls Avenue, Twin Falls, ID 83301.

What is the purpose of this form?
The IRS Verification of Non-Filing Letter is essential for students and parents who have not filed taxes. It serves as proof of non-filing status required by educational institutions during financial aid verification. By obtaining and submitting this letter, individuals can ensure their eligibility for federal student aid.

What is the IRS Verification of Non-Filing Letter?
It is a document provided by the IRS confirming that no tax return has been filed for a certain tax year.
How do I obtain the IRS Verification of Non-Filing Letter?
You can obtain it online or through the IRS Help Line.
Do I need this letter for financial aid?
Yes, it's required if you or your parents have not filed taxes.
How long does it take to receive the letter?
Typically, it takes 5 to 10 days once requested via phone.

Is there a fee for obtaining the letter?
No, the IRS does not charge a fee for the Verification of Non-Filing Letter.
